The company is looking to convert the entire $149 million value of outstanding bonds into 98.5% of its enlarged share capital following a proposed share issue, and is also in talks with bondholders to secure a working capital facility of up to $10 million.

Xcite said the proposed restructuring would give it a “significantly stronger balance sheet” and working capital to pursue development of the Bentley heavy oil field off the UK that has been stalled by its financial challenges, as well as low oil prices that have hit commerciality.
